Geocache Description:

This is a base level cache of the Zodiac Series and one of the Water elements.

The twelve signs of the zodiac each have an element associated with them. The four elements are Earth, Air, Fire and Water.

The Elements

Fire signs are Aries, Leo and Sagittarius. The co-ordinates for Sagittarius will be found in the Aries and Leo caches.

 

 

Water signs are Scorpio, Cancer and Pisces. The co-ordinates for Pisces will be found in the Scorpio and Cancer caches.

 

 

Air Signs are Gemini, Libra and Aquarius. The co-ordinates for Gemini will be found in the Aquarius and Libra caches.

 

 

Earth signs are Taurus, Virgo and Capricorn. The co-ordinates for Virgo will be found in the Taurus and Capricorn caches.

 

 

 

Co-ordinates for the bonus " ZODIAC CACHE" will be found in the Sagittarius, Pisces, Gemini, and Virgo caches. A diagram illustrating the series can be found here .

If the Mere's Visitors Centre is open when you are in the area it is well worth a visit. They are open daily till mid October, Weekends only from then till Christmas, Closed in January and February, reopening Thursdays-Sundays in March for the nesting season. In the spring they have web cams with live feed on the grey heron nesting areas around the mere.

The Ellesmere area is known as the Shropshire Lake District with a number of glacial meres in the area. A natural nesting area for lots of water fowl and the grey heron in particular. There are picnic areas nearby and a playground for the children. The walk to the cache is along a paved area and both buggy and handicap friendly, however a wheelchair user would need a partner to retrieve the cache.
